Conditions / Refusal Reasons
The development to which this permission relates must be begun not later than the expiration of three years beginning with the date of this permission. Reason: By virtue of Sections 91 to 95 of the Town and Country Planning Act 1990 as amended by section 51 of the Planning and Compulsory Purchase Act 2004.

That the development hereby approved shall be carried out in accordance with the details shown on the following approved plans, 1149/20, 1149/21, 1149/23b and 1149/24a, except as controlled or modified by conditions of this permission. Reason: To secure the proper planning of the area in accordance with Development Plan policies.

That the materials to be used for the external walls and roof of the extension shall be of the same colour, type and texture as those used on the existing two storey extension. Reason: To ensure that the details of the development are satisfactory in accordance with Policies C2, D1, G6 and H13 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an 2011.

The exterior of the garage hereby permitted shall only be constructed in the materials specified on the plans hereby approved or in materials which shall previously have been appro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ority. Reason: In the interests of the appearance of the development and in accordance with Policies C2, D1, G6 and H13 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an 2011.

Notwithstanding the provisions of the Town and Country Planning (General Permitted Development) Order 1995 (or any order revoking or re-enacting that Order), no window(s), door(s) or other openings other than those shown on the approved plans shall be inserted in the walls or roof of the garage hereby permitted. Reason: To safeguard the amenities of adjoining occupiers and the character of the area in accordance with Policies D1, G6, H13 and C2 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an 2011.

The outbuilding hereby permitted shall not be occupied at any time other than for purposes incidental to the residential use of the dwelling known as Kates Cottage. Reason: The creation of a separate dwelling in this location would result in an undesirable division of the plot and inadequate levels of privacy for the occupiers of Kates Cottage and the new dwelling and would lead to highway implications contrary to Policies D4 and T2 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an 2011.

That any trees that are damaged or removed as a result of the development shall be replaced in accordance with a landscaping scheme to be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ority. The scheme shall be implemented as approved within 12 months of the commencement of the approved development and thereafter be maintained in accordance with the approved scheme. In the event of any of the trees or shrubs so planted dying or being seriously damaged within 5 years of the completion of the development, a new tree of a species first approved by the Local Planning Authority shall be planted and properly maintained in a position first approved by the Local Authority. Reason: To ensure that there is no net loss in the districts biodiversity resources in accordance with Policy C6 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an 2011.
